Downed power line found in trees near bridge west of Virginia, Mckinney TX


A downed neutral power line was found tangled in trees near the bridge west of Virginia street. There was no active fire or arcing observed. A fuse on the utility pole near the location was blown, causing a haze. The power company was notified to address the hazard.
